Researchers have developed a new framework for feature transformation learning that addresses limitations in existing generative approaches. This framework captures hierarchical relationships between features and operations while maintaining permutation invariance, which is crucial for unbiased exploration of transformation sequences. It also employs a policy-guided reinforcement learning strategy to optimize both predictive accuracy and transformation efficiency, demonstrating superior performance on various tabular benchmarks.
